Mandeep blitz wins RCB a thriller

Rain was threatening to spoil the day again for Royal Challengers Bangalore and Kolkata Knight Riders, both of whom had a match washed out earlier  BCCI
David Wiese dismissed Gautam Gambhir in the fourth over, after he had put on 33 with Robin Uthappa for the opening stand  BCCI

Despite the fall of Uthappa, Andre Russell blasted three sixes and five fours for his 17-ball 45 before being run out by Dinesh Karthik, leaving Knight Riders on 96 for 3  BCCI
Yusuf Pathan and Ryan ten Doeschate struck two sixes and a four between them to take Knight Riders to 111 for 4 in 10 overs  BCCI
Chris Gayle hit three sixes for his 9-ball 21 before holing out to Russell at long-on in the fourth over  BCCI
Piyush Chawla sent the crowd at the M Chinnaswamy into deafening silence when he dismissed AB de Villiers for 2 with Royal Challengers needing 62 from 32  BCCI
Virat Kohli was next to fall, mis-timing a Russell delivery to Suryakumar Yadav at long-on, leaving the hosts 81 for 3 in the seventh over  BCCI
Mandeep Singh, though, remained ice-cool, blasting three sixes and four fours in his 45 from just 18 balls to hand Royal Challengers a seven-wicket win  BCCI
